Output 1584a266fe22035b0b66abedca5175c1be1cb8135d962424a34798fcb4792f59:31

value
13775454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ab9c340ce0e21572f25f2bc2f2973acc6bb0054 OP_EQUAL
address
3CsvtxzmLj6tLa5mLJNJEB7pJXmYkudyxo
transaction
1584a266fe22035b0b66abedca5175c1be1cb8135d962424a34798fcb4792f59
spent
true